AllBlue-Blender-Tools:Blender附加组件集,优化您的3D工作流
需积分: 5 108 浏览量
更新于2024-11-06
收藏 25KB ZIP 举报
资源摘要信息:"AllBlue-Blender-Tools 是一组专门设计为Blender软件的附加组件,旨在提高用户的工作效率和项目管理能力。Blender是一款开源的3D创作套件,支持完整的3D制作流程,包括建模、动画、模拟、渲染、合成和运动跟踪,甚至视频编辑和游戏创建。附加组件(Add-on)是Blender的一个重要特性,允许用户扩展软件的功能,满足特定的创作需求。AllBlue-Blender-Tools包含多个实用工具,每个都有其特定的功能和应用场景,以下是对这些工具的详细介绍:
文件浏览器搜索工具:
Blender内置的文件浏览器是处理各种资源(如图片、视频、音频文件等)的重要界面。此附加组件为文件浏览器增加了搜索功能,使用户可以快速找到所需的文件,无论是本地的资源文件还是链接的附加资源。搜索功能还可以扩展到打开文件夹、添加图像或电影、以及打开*.blend文件,这些都是日常工作流中常见的需求。
附加工具:
此工具允许用户根据当前操作的*.blend文件的特性来启用或禁用附加组件,而不是像通常那样在用户首选项中设置。这使得针对特定项目的优化变得可能,例如,某个附加组件只在处理特定类型的场景时启用,这样既节省了资源又提高了效率。
Group Particles Tools:
Blender中的粒子系统非常强大,但有时需要更好的控制粒子的显示方式。Group Particles Tools添加了一个“隐藏”功能,允许用户将粒子视作对象组。这在进行大规模粒子模拟时尤其有用,可以让粒子的管理变得更加直观和高效。
网格排序工具:
网格排序工具允许用户以更高级的方式对网格进行排序。它可以与其他工具结合使用,例如粒子系统或构建/爆炸修改器,以实现复杂的动画效果和模拟。这对于复杂的动画项目或需要大量粒子和网格交互的场景尤为重要。
动画渲染层:
渲染层的动画是一个高级功能,它允许用户使用关键帧控制不同的渲染层。这样做的好处是可以为不同的层设置不同的动画,例如,在一个场景中加速渲染过程,或者在另一个场景中替换对象,比如使用来自不同层的破碎物体的动画效果。这对于视觉效果和动态变化场景的创作尤其有帮助。
【标签】"Python" 表明这些附加组件是使用Python语言开发的,这是Blender内置的脚本语言,非常适合用来创建和扩展Blender的功能,同时也是开源社区中非常受欢迎的编程语言。由于Python的易用性和强大的库支持,使得开发Blender附加组件成为可能,同时也便于社区成员间的交流和协作。
【压缩包子文件的文件名称列表】中的"Master"可能表明这是附加组件的源代码或资源包的主文件夹名称,用于存放完整的工具包,包括所需的脚本、文档和其他资源。在Blender社区中,这样的资源包通常通过GitHub或其他代码托管平台共享,以方便用户下载、安装和使用。"AllBlue-Blender-Tools-master"的命名也暗示着开发者可能遵循了某种版本控制的命名规则,"master"在此场景下通常指主分支或最新稳定版的代码。"
160 浏览量
2021-12-19 上传
2021-01-30 上传
2021-02-16 上传
2021-02-06 上传
2021-06-26 上传
2021-06-14 上传
2021-04-18 上传
2021-05-25 上传
阔喵撩影
- 粉丝: 32
- 资源: 4662
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程